About the Role Lead the implementation of clinical risk management and patient safety frameworks across the organisation, taking ownership of specific programme areas, driving process improvements, and building capability among staff and clinical teams. The role coordinates across departments to ensure consistent application of safety standards.
Key Responsibilities
- Lead clinical risk management strategies aligned with organisational objectives, NHG cluster priorities, and regulatory requirements, including maintaining risk appetite frameworks and governance structures.
- Maintain a clinical risk registry with data analytics capabilities, and drive digital transformation initiatives including automated reporting and data visualisation tools.
- Prepare and present risk analysis reports to governance committees (QPIC, EXCO, NHG Group Quality), and facilitate risk discussions with clinical chiefs and departmental leads.
- Lead patient safety adverse event and near-miss management, including promoting incident reporting, investigating serious safety events, identifying root causes, and analysing aggregate incident data.
- Develop and coordinate patient safety initiatives promoting a culture of safety, including morbidity and mortality reviews, clinical quality reviews, patient safety walkabouts, and safety committees.
- Design and deliver training programmes for clinical leaders and staff, developing e-learning platforms, simulation scenarios, and workshops, and mentor junior staff.
- Lead horizon scanning through ECRI reports, international literature, and industry networks to identify emerging global risks.
